Hi, I have a 1990 GMC Vandura work van, 5.7,... and it recently began acting up on me. Always been a great work van for me. It will run ok to take it somewhere (Fortunately),...but every now and then when it is idling it will lose half of it's RPM's and then rev up and down about twice and then just die. But it will start back up and run fine as I begin to drive it. So far,.. (AC Delco) distributor and cap, rotor, ignition module, fuel filter and fuel pump. Oh yea,... and lots of head scratching. Also when you turn the ignition on to engage the pump it runs for no less than thirty seconds every time, should be about three seconds I thought. Don't know if this is part of the other issue or not. Would greatly appreciate any suggestions, and thanks!!

I have a 1991 k2500 5.7l, so I am going to assume the fuel control is similar. The fuel pump is supposed to run for 20sec with the key turned to the on position and eninge not running, this was to take care of hot fuel vapor lock causing starting issues. as far as the idle issue, i have read a few posts that have had similar problems caused by a bad ECM ground on the motor near the water filler neck or, like on my truck, on the intake bolt drivers side near the front of the engine. I have heard that the ground located on the water filler neck is a bad location for it and can cause problems. Or it could be the idle air control valve with controls the air density during idle operations and i think some off idle conditions as well. but I know for sure that it controls the idle speed with no throttle. (if you unplug it and start the engine my will run at ~1200 rpm instead of 750rpm).
